Report of Classis West

Joshua Engelsma·2024-04-15
Read Full Article on Standard Bearer

This article reports on the March 2024 meeting of Classis West of the Protestant Reformed Churches, detailing routine ecclesiastical business, committee work, and notably the classis's handling of a legally-challenged appeal regarding church discipline in a case of sexual abuse at Crete PRC. The report provides insight into the denominational governance structures and processes of the PRC, including how the classis addressed serious matters of church discipline and denominational communication.

Meeting March 6-7, 2024 Classis West of the Protestant Reformed Church­es met on March 6-7, 2024, in Randolph (WI) PRC. The congregation did an outstanding job of hosting the twenty-five delegates from the thirteen churches in the Classis, as well as a number of visitors. Classis began on Wednesday, March 6, with open­ing devotions led by the chairman of the previous meet­ing, Rev. John Marcus (pastor of Peace PRC), who gave a fitting meditation on Solomon's request for wisdom from I Kings 3....
